Representation.IntertwiningMap.centralAlgebraMul_apply
∀ {A : Type u_1} {G : Type u_2} {V : Type u_3} [inst : CommSemiring A] [inst_1 : Monoid G] [inst_2 : AddCommMonoid V]
[inst_3 : Module A V] (ρ : Representation A G V) {z : MonoidAlgebra A G}
(hz : z ∈ Submonoid.center (MonoidAlgebra A G)) (v : V),
(Representation.IntertwiningMap.centralAlgebraMul ρ hz) v = (ρ.asAlgebraHom z) v- Cited by
